New Haven, CT Apartments for Rent

You can find the perfect place in New Haven, CT with the many options of apartments for rent. Downtown New Haven is ideal if you want to be close to Yale University, a range of restaurants, and cultural attractions like theaters and museums. East Rock is another popular choice, favored for its tree-lined streets and proximity to parks. If you’re looking for quieter areas, consider Westville, which is known for its artistic community and access to walking trails.

New Haven’s public transportation system includes buses and nearby rail options, making commutes manageable for many renters. The city is also well-suited for those working in education, healthcare, and research, given the concentration of employers in these fields. You’ll enjoy the convenience of a city that balances local entertainment, shopping, and outdoor spaces when you live in an apartment for rent in New Haven. It’s a place where you can settle in while still finding plenty to do within a short distance.


New Haven, CT Rental Insights

Average Rent Rates

What is the average rent in New Haven, CT?

The average rent in New Haven is $2,087. When you rent an apartment in New Haven, you can expect to pay as little as $1,825 or as much as $2,578, depending on the location and the size of the apartment.

What is the average rent of a Studio apartment in New Haven, CT?

The average rent for a studio apartment in New Haven, CT is $1,825 per month.

What is the average rent of a 1 bedroom apartment in New Haven, CT?

The average rent for a one bedroom apartment in New Haven, CT is $2,090 per month.

What is the average rent of a 2 bedroom apartment in New Haven, CT?

The average rent for a two bedroom apartment in New Haven, CT is $2,387 per month.

What is the average rent of a 3 bedroom apartment in New Haven, CT?

The average rent for a three bedroom apartment in New Haven, CT is $2,578 per month.

Education

What are the top Elementary schools in New Haven, CT?

In New Haven, you’ll find top-ranking elementary schools like Worthington Hooker School, Barack H. Obama Magnet University School, and Mauro-Sheridan Magnet School.

What are the top middle schools in New Haven, CT?

New Haven is home to some top-ranking middle schools, including Worthington Hooker School, Mauro-Sheridan Magnet School, and Truman School.

What are the top high schools in New Haven, CT?

Moving is tough for high school students! Look for New Haven apartments near top-ranking high schools like Metropolitan Business High School, Cooperative High School, and New Haven Academy.

What colleges and universities are in New Haven, CT?

If you’re a student moving to an apartment in New Haven, you’ll have access to Yale University, Main Campus, University of New Haven, and Albertus Magnus College.
